More about the restaurant: La Beirut
Falafel, hummus, halloumi and shawarma – these are the foods that most often come to mind when one thinks of Lebanese cuisine (and they’re absolutely delicious). But how about smaka harah, lubya and makanek? At Sydney’s La Beirut, you can sample all of the aforementioned dishes, plus several others, in the restaurant’s lovely premises, along the Killara stretch of the Pacific Highway, with the golf club behind.

Available for your eating pleasure seven days a week, La Beirut up the Pacific Highway is your one-stop shop for all things Lebanese north of Sydney city. Featuring beautiful oriental decorations with an upscale feel, Killara’s La Beirut is the perfect destination for a special evening out with friends or family members in a lovely setting. The restaurant is ideal for private functions, too, and can seat up to 130 guests in the dining room and up to 60 on the terrace.
Take a gander at La Beirut’s large menu of exquisite food and drink options and take your pick from a number of hot and cold meze, mains, salads and more. Or go for one of the banquet options, like the seafood banquet, which includes (here we go) hummus, baba ganoush, labneh, tabouli, fattoush, sambousek, falafel, fried kibbe, potato coriander, fish, lamb, kafta, chicken, and lebanese desserts, alongside a tasty cup of bold coffee.
